Joey Barton slams Karl Henry

Queens Park Rangers captain Joey Barton has continued his verbal row with Wolverhampton Wanderers' Karl Henry, expressing his dislike for the midfielder during a television interview.

The two players lined up against each other yesterday during QPR's 3-0 victory at Molineux.

Speaking to Goals on Sunday, Barton aired his views on Henry, while also insisting on calling him Kelvin.

"Kelvin Henry – he loves it, doesn't he," said the 29-year-old. "Always sticking his foot in and trying to hurt people. Why doesn't he do it when it is 0-0 in the game?

"He is chirping up all week saying he is going to do x, y and z to me and then he lets himself down massively by not even turning up on Saturday afternoons. He should concentrate more on playing and less on talking a good game."

Barton opened the scoring during yesterday's win.
